About MS 890
MS 890 is a public middle school in Brooklyn, NY, part of New York City Geographic District #22, serving approximately 314 students in grades 6th-8th with a 10.1:1 student-teacher ratio. It holds a MySchoolScout rating of 8.3 out of 10 and ranks #452 of 4,742 schools in NY. State assessment records show 27%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2017-2022) and 46%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2017-2022).
